Episode 81: Building a Future-Proof HR Consultancy – Key Lessons from Episodes 72, 73, 74 and 80

Host: Mary Asante

What does it take to build a successful, sustainable and future-proof HR consultancy in today's rapidly changing business environment?

In this special recap episode of HR Voices, Mary Asante brings together the key insights from four recent episodes covering employment law, LinkedIn, consultancy growth and HR audits.

Drawing on expert discussions with Amanda Trewhella, Meg Hudson and Tania Harland, Mary explores the common themes emerging across the HR consulting profession and what independent HR consultants need to focus on to thrive.

In this episode, we cover:

✅ Employment Rights Act 2025 and what the upcoming employment law changes mean for employers and HR consultants

✅ Why staying ahead of employment law developments creates opportunities to support clients proactively

✅ How LinkedIn can help HR consultants increase visibility, build credibility and attract new clients

✅ The importance of content, connections and conversations in growing a consultancy business

✅ The most common challenges HR consultants are facing right now, including pricing, positioning, client acquisition and retainers

✅ Why HR expertise alone is not enough when running a consultancy business
